Understanding the Landscape: SMEs and the Future of Work
The Rise of Remote Work
The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ated a trend that was already in motionโremote work. Today, many SMEs are faced with the challenge of maintaining productivity and collaboration among dispersed teams. A survey by the Office for National Statistics (ONS) revealed that over 40% of businesses in the UK have adopted remote work policies, and this shift is likely here to stay. However, this shift does not come without its challenges.
Pain Points for SMEs
- Communication Barriers: Traditional methods of communication, such as emails and in-person meetings, can become cumbersome when teams are not in the same location. Miscommunication and misunderstandings can lead to delays and frustration.
-
Data Security Risks: With the increase of remote work, the potential for cyber threats has also escalated. SMEs often lack the robust cybersecurity measures necessary to protect sensitive information.
- Limited Collaboration Tools: Many SMEs continue to rely on outdated technology or software that does not support effective collaboration. This can hinder teamwork and innovation.
-
Scalability Issues: As SMEs grow, their IT needs will evolve. Without a flexible and scalable solution, businesses may struggle to keep up with demand.
-
Cost Constraints: Budget limitations can prevent SMEs from investing in the latest technologies, leaving them at a disadvantage compared to larger enterprises.
Embracing Cloud Solutions: A Pathway to Enhanced Collaboration
What Are Cloud Solutions?
Cloud solutions refer to services that are delivered over the internet, allowing users to access data, applications, and resources remotely. These solutions can range from cloud storage to comprehensive cloud-based software that supports various business functions.
Benefits of Cloud Solutions for SMEs
- Improved Communication: Cloud-based collaboration tools, such as Microsoft Teams, Slack, or Google Workspace, enable real-time communication, breaking down geographical barriers and fostering teamwork.
-
Enhanced Data Security: Reputable cloud service providers invest heavily in cybersecurity measures, providing SMEs with access to top-notch security protocols without the need to manage them in-house.
-
Scalability and Flexibility: Cloud solutions are designed to grow with your business. As your needs change, you can easily scale your services up or down, ensuring you only pay for what you use.
-
Cost-Effectiveness: Cloud solutions often operate on a subscription basis, meaning SMEs can avoid hefty upfront costs associated with traditional IT infrastructures. This model allows for better budget management and financial planning.
-
Access to Advanced Technologies: By leveraging cloud services, SMEs can access the latest technologies, including artificial intelligence (AI) and data analytics, enabling them to remain competitive in their industries.
Addressing Cybersecurity Concerns
While cloud solutions offer significant advantages, they also present unique challenges, particularly concerning cybersecurity. SMEs must take proactive steps to safeguard their data and systems.
1. Implement Robust Security Measures
-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A): Require users to provide multiple forms of verification before accessing sensitive information. This adds an extra layer of security.
- Regular Data Backups: Ensure that data is regularly backed up to prevent loss in case of a cyber incident. Cloud services often include automatic backup features.
-
Employee Training: Educate employees about cybersecurity best practices, including recognizing phishing scams and using strong passwords.
2. Partner with Managed IT Services
Managed IT services can provide SMEs with the expertise and resources necessary to maintain a secure IT environment. These services can include:
- 24/7 Monitoring: Constant surveillance of your IT infrastructure to identify and address potential threats before they become significant issues.
-
Incident Response: Having a plan in place for responding to cybersecurity incidents can minimize damage and reduce downtime.
- Compliance Management: Ensuring that your business adheres to legal and regulatory requirements regarding data protection and privacy is crucial for avoiding penalties.
